Nextcloud is a free, open-source, self-hosted platform that acts like a private Google Drive or Dropbox. It allows users to store, sync, and share files, calendars, contacts, and photos, while offering features like video calls, chat, and document editing.

Dolibarr is an open-source, modular enterprise resource planning (ERP) and customer relationship management (CRM) system that was developed to facilitate the management of many company activities, including sales and invoicing, as well as projects and inventory. It is available for self-hosting or cloud use.

PolySysMon is a system monitoring solution that enables the collection of comprehensive information regarding all facets of your business, from hardware health to account status, while facilitating data organization for interpretation, trend analysis, and event alerting.

Examples

When a company signs up for PolySaaS at the $100/user/mo unlimited level, they instantly get access to the full bundled suite, which includes Odoo, SuiteCRM, NextCloud, Gmail, PolySysMon, Monitor Logger, Dolibarr, Celery, MatterMost, and WordPress. All of these apps are already integrated, single sign-on is enabled, and they are ready to use, with data automatically syncing across the stack.

In real time, this is how it goes:
A new customer joins the business through a WordPress form on its website. PolySaaS middleware listens for the submission event and looks at the tenant’s dynamic directions. These are the instructions:

Start Atomic Service #1 (check form info)
Start Atomic Service #2 and make a start in SuiteCRM.
Run Atomic Service #3 to make an Odoo record for a customer.
Run Atomic Service #4 to create a NextCloud user account.
Run Atomic Service #5 (make an account on Gmail).
Launch Atomic Service #6 to add a person to the MatterMost team channel.
Start Atomic Service #7 and send a full audit record to the Monitor Logger.
Run Atomic Service #8 (put a Celery job in the background to check on the progress of onboarding through PolySysMon).
All of this happens instantly and without any help from a person. It starts with a welcome email from Gmail, then moves on to a unique onboarding folder in NextCloud and a MatterMost people get a welcome letter with links to their teams, and SuiteCRM and Odoo already have information about them. If the customer later upgrades or adds a service, like Dolibarr for billing, all you have to do is change the directions. The new provisioning step will be added automatically to all future signups.
